Virus claims ten more lives in JK

November 25, 2020 | BK News Service

Jammu and Kashmir reported ten more covid-19 related deaths, taking the number of those who as per official data succumbed to the virus so far in J&K to 1651.

Among the victims, the officials said that six were from Kashmir Valley and four from Jammu division.
Those from Valley include a 70-year-old woman from Uri Baramulla, a 64-year-old from Imam Sahib Shopian and a 60-year-old man from Bogund Kulgam besides three from Srinagar—a 69-year-old man from Zaina Kadal, a 60-year-old from Shuhama and a 79-year-old Tengpora.
The victims from Jammu division include one resident each from the winter capital of the J&K, Udhampur, Doda and Samba.
With these deaths, the total fatality count in the Valley has reached 1085 and 566 in the Jammu region.
Srinagar district with 408 deaths tops the list followed by Jammu (292), Baramulla (160), Budgam (99), Pulwama (86), Kupwara (81), Anantnag (77), Doda (53), Bandipora(50), Kulgam (50), Rajouri (49), Udhampur (43), Ganderbal (37), Shopian (37), Kathua (35), Samba (27), Poonch (22), Ramban (18), Kishtwar(16), and Reasi (9).
